FM.indd 7 3/24/2016 12:36:48 PM FM.indd 8 3/24/2016 12:36:48 PM ACING THE GATE ABOUT GATE EXAMINATION The Graduate Admission Test in Engineering (GATE) is an All-India level competitive examination for engineering graduates interested in pursuing Masters or Ph.D. programmes in India The examination tests the examinees in General Aptitude, Engineering Mathematics and the discipline (subject) of study in the undergraduate course. The objective of GATE is to identify meritorious and motivated candidates for higher studies in Engineering and Sciences. The examination serves as a benchmark for normalisation of the undergraduate engineering education in the country. The level of competitiveness can be gauged from the fact that close to ten lakh students appear in this competitive examination every year. Admission to Higher Learning Courses A valid GATE score is essential to become eligible for admission to the post-graduate courses in Engineering, that is, M.Tech, M.E. or direct doctoral programme in the Indian higher education institutes. Although qualifying the GATE examination entitles you to apply for the higher degrees; achieving qualifying score is definitely not enough if one is aspiring for admission to top institutes like the IITs, the NITs, the Indian Institute of Science (IISc) and some of the high ranked universities. For this, a high GATE score is important. Needless to say, a percentile of greater than 95 is perhaps the least one needs to secure admission to a top institute. A total of 804463 candidates appeared for GATE 2015 out of which about 125851 students belonged to Electrical branch of engineering. It is important to mention here that only 15.05% of those who appeared could qualify according to the qualifying marks set by the GATE examination committee. Financial Assistance Selected GATE qualified candidates admitted to M.Tech programmes in Colleges/Universities all over India are eligible for obtaining financial assistance. The financial assistance is awarded to Indian nationals doing the M.Tech programmes, subject to institute rules.
